## Fuel reports 101

Welcome aboard! The weekly fleet fuel-usage report is generated by a small job called Gulper, which pulls odometer and pump data from the Tarnwick depot service and rolls it into a CSV for the ops folks. It runs Monday mornings; if it breaks, you're the lucky fixer. Gulper authenticates to the Tarnwick service with the key below.

API key for kahop-bagef: zpat2_yb

This PR reworks the Tallbridge fleet fuel-usage report to aggregate per-depot rather than per-vehicle, fixing the double-counting seen in the Ashgrove rollout. All figures were cross-checked against last quarter's manual audit. Please review the smoothing and outlier thresholds carefully, as they directly affect the published numbers.

constants for fawep-yagap:
QUOTAS = {
    "noveth": 275,
    "oliion": 740,
}

**14:22 — EXIF scrubbing regression confirmed.** Uploads through the Pictobin ingest service bypassed the Scrubjay sanitizer after the queue rename at 13:50. GPS and device tags persisted on roughly 4,100 images. Mira from Trust flushed the CDN cache; reprocessing job kicked off at 14:31. If you're new: Scrubjay must run before any asset hits public storage, no exceptions. The affected worker build that shipped without the sanitizer hook is identified below.

pipeline stamp: htk9_6ce9d33c5

### Runbook 4.2 — Account Recovery (Matchline Service)

During long GC pauses, the Matchline pairing nodes may drop operator sessions, locking the recovery console. Verify pause duration in the heap log before proceeding. Restart the console with the break-glass account, which requires dual approval from on-call and security. The console prompts once, then expects the passphrase shown below.

vault phrase of bagaf-kajeg = jorath-feniel-briir-siliel-ralix